NEAR Protocol recently highlighted a significant gap in the cryptocurrency space, differentiating between what many blockchain projects promise and what they actually deliver in production. According to a tweet from NEAR Protocol, a study by @Itsfloe observed that while many chains are still planning features for the future, NEAR has already implemented critical advancements. NEAR claims it has made substantial strides in parallel sharded execution, stateless validation, and post-quantum security, which are features that competitors are only planning for future releases. The implication here is that NEAR has positioned itself ahead of many rivals, possibly attracting developers and projects looking for a more advanced platform. This situation creates a dynamic where NEAR’s capabilities could redefine its market position as developers seek platforms that deliver on their promises.

NEAR Protocol operates as a layer-one blockchain designed to facilitate the development of decentralized applications. Its unique architecture allows for scalability and speed, making it attractive for developers.
